Character Bio

Bobbie Barrett is the wife/manager of comic Jimmy Barrett who was hired by Sterling Cooper to do TV spots for Utz Potato Chips. Bobbie's relationship with the agency becomes more complicated, however, when Jimmy insults a client and Don begins an affair with her. Their affair is temporarily derailed when the two have a car accident while driving to the beach. Recuperating at Peggy's apartment afterwards, Bobbie sums up her strategy for making it in a man's world: "You can't be a man," she advises. "Be a woman. It's powerful business when done correctly." Bobbie's relationship with Don ends when he learns she's been gossiping about him.
